How much does a 320 GB 7200 RPM Hard Drive for a Notebook Costs?

I Really need to know, and Vista Ultimate 32 Bits supports 4 GB?
Asus Tek said to me that yes.

And does Vista x64 is better for gaming?

Hi,

4gb is the max any 32bit system can support - 64bit architecture can in theory use 6000gb - I believe Vista 64bit Ultimate can support up to 128gb - good luck finding a motherboard which can handle that.

In my experience, 64-bit Vista with 4GB's of RAM beats 32-bit Vista and Windows XP hands-down as far as gaming is concerned. With the same machine only using 2GB's of RAM, XP is the better gaming OS, followed by 32-bit Vista and then 64-bit.

Hard drive prices are going to depend on where you shop. I have no clue what prices are like in Brazil. I can tell you that US customers going to newegg.com can get them for ~ $160.00.

Hi,

32bit supports 4gb but the o/s reserves some so you see a little less, around 3.6gb I believe.

Check the manufacturer's website to see if your notebook supports 64bit .


Laptop/notebook hard drives are smaller than than those for desktop pc's
2.5" ? as opposed to 3.5" - don't recall the exact size for a laptop, but it's definitely smaller .
